Reviewing the Convenience Aspect of Cashmere Garments
What qualities underline the convenience aspect of cashmere garments? The gentleness of cashmere is the very first quality to consider. Its deluxe structure makes it seem like a second skin, giving heat without the weight or itching connected with various other woollen products. In addition, cashmere's one-of-a-kind fiber framework enables breathability, regulating temperature and stopping overheating. The product's flexibility and durability make certain that it molds versus the body conveniently, maintaining its form over time. Cashmere's hypoallergenic buildings also contribute to its convenience, making it a suitable option for sensitive skin. The capacity to layer cashmere pieces without thickness enhances the comfort variable. Basically, the convenience of cashmere is derived from its gentleness, breathability, durability, hypoallergenic nature, and adaptability.

The Ecological Impact and Sustainability of Cashmere
While the comfort and beauty of cashmere are most certainly appealing, it's equally vital to consider its relationship with the atmosphere. Cashmere manufacturing, mostly in Mongolia and China, entails raising cashmere goats, which can considerably strain delicate grassland environments because of overgrazing. This can cause desertification, a pushing environmental issue. The processing of cashmere, entailing dyeing and washing, can additionally add to water contamination if not correctly managed. Initiatives are being made to develop sustainable cashmere production approaches, such as rotational grazing and cleaner handling methods. Hence, while cashmere has ecological effects, its sustainability mostly depends on manufacturing practices.
